ANALISIS KEMAMPUAN BERPIKIR KRITIS DAN SELF REGULATION PESERTA DIDIK MELALUI PEMBELAJARAN MENGGUNAKAN MODEL MULTIPEL REPRESENTASI Dea Chrestella; Nukhbatul Bidayati Haka; Supriyadi Supriyadi
BIO EDUCATIO : (The Journal of Science and Biology Education) Vol 6, No 2 (2021): Bio Educatio (The Journal of Science and Biology Education)
Publisher : Universitas Majalengka

Abstract

ABSTRAKPermasalahan yang ditemukan di SMAN 15 Bandar Lampung yakni kegiatan pembelajaran berlangsung tidak sistematis dan hanya diberikan tugas. Selain itu, pendidik dalam kegiatan pembelajaran banyak menjelasan materi sehingga tidak ada kesempatan untuk peserta didik mengembangkan self regulation dalam proses pembelajaran. Penelitian ini dilaksanakan untuk melihat pengaruh model multipel representasi pada kemampuan berpikir kritis dan self regulation peserta didik. Metode yang dipakai yakni quasi exsperiment design dengan pengambilan teknik sampel penelitian yakni teknik cluster random sampling. Adapun desain eksperimennya berupa Pretest-Posttest Control Grup Design. Keterbaruan berupa variabel terikat yang digunakan yakni kemampuan berpikir kritis dan self regulation. Hasil penelitian berupa (1) Model multipel representasi berpengaruh pada kemampuan berpikir kritis dan self regulation berdasarkan uji manova nilai signifikansi . (2) Model multipel representasi dapat menaikkan kemampuan berpikir kritis dan self regulation dalam kegiatan pembelajaran biologi berdasarkan hasil uji between Subject Effects yakni 0,000 dan 0,000 yang artinya hipotesis diterima.Kata Kunci: Kemampuan Bepikir Kritis, Model Multipel Representasi, Self Regulation ABSTRACKThe problem found at SMAN 15 Bandar Lampung is that learning activities take place not systematically and are only given assignments. In addition, educators in learning activities explain a lot of material so that there is no opportunity for students to develop self-regulation in the learning process. This study was conducted to see the effect of multiple representation models on students' critical thinking skills and self-regulation. The method used is a quasi-experimental design by taking the research sample technique, namely the cluster random sampling technique. The experimental design is in the form of Pretest-Posttest Control Group Design. The novelty of the dependent variable used is critical thingking skills and self-regulation. The results of the research are (1) multiple representation model has an effect on critical thinking skills and self-regulation based on the manova test of significance value. (2) The multiple representation model can increase critical thinking skills and self-regulation in biology learning activities based on the between Subject Effects test results, namely 0.000 and 0.000, which means that the hypothesis is accepted.Key words: Critical Thinking Skils, Multiple Representation Model, Self Regulation
